show flowstats

show flowstats {<portlist> | export {<group#>} {detail}}
Description
Displays status information for the flow statistics function.

Summary status for a port includes the following information:
• Values of all flow statistics configuration parameters
• Count of flow records that have been exported
• Counts of the number of packets/bytes for which flow statistics were not maintained due to
insufficient resources
Summary status for an export group port includes the following information:
• Values of all configuration parameters
• State of each export destination device
Detailed status for an export group includes the information reported in the summary status along with
the following additional management counters:
• Counts of flow records that have been exported to each flow-collector destination
• Counts of the number of times each flow-collector destination has been taken out of service due to
health-check failures
